The authors examine the implementation and current status of two techniques which are capable of imaging the distribution of exogenous, free radical based contrast agents in vivo, namely electron paramagnetic resonance imaging (EPRI) and proton-electron double-resonance imaging (PEDRI). Both EPRI and PEDRI use electron paramagnetic resonance (EPR) to detect and image the distribution of the free radical in the object under study.
